August 15, 2018 – Zero-Max introduced Zero-Max Crown Right Angle Gear Drives. Motion system designers looking for a right angle gear drive will find Zero-Max Crown Gear Drives a suitable choice.

Lubricated for life with Beacon 325 premium grade grease, Zero-Max Crown drives feature heat treated AGMA Class 10 spiral bevel gears. This combination of bearing design and lubrication formulation ensures maintenance free operation for industrial applications. The drives feature precision hardened and ground ball bearings handling speeds up to 2000 rpm in most operating environments. The internal gears are permanently mounted to the shafts with the use of a press-fit and locking pins. This provides a connection for use in heavy load applications.

Lubrication with Beacon 325 grease ensures performance in temperature ranges from -50° C to +120° C without evaporation. This is especially important in sealed for life systems using motors, generators and similar equipment in industrial applications.

Zero-Max drives are assembled for bearing and gear alignment. The drives are pre-lubricated during assembly, then enclosed in an anodized aluminum housing.

Zero-Max Crown drives are intended for a range of machine applications including food processing, packaging and material handling systems. Available in many sizes and models, they are ideal for a wide range of horsepower, torque and shaft speed requirements. Standard two and three way models are available with 1:1 and 2:1 speed ratios in shaft diameter combinations of 3/8, 1/2, 5/8 and 3/4 inch.
